    Beretta vs CP99 and silencer advice please

    I currently have a CP99 with laser and silencer that i'm happy enough with but my friend is selling a nickel beretta with a laser which feels much meatier and better in the hand. my questions are, firstly can the beretta be fitted with a silencer as its just too damn loud for my garden and secondly, is the beretta any more powerful or any better than the CP99?
    i'd greatly appreciate some expert advice from you lads.
    atvb
    Dave
    P.S. what should i be looking to pay for a mint, boxed nickel beretta with laser ? bearing in mind its from a friend so i dont want to rip him off. ta.

    Buy the Beretta - the trigger alone is in a different league to the CP99.

    As far as power difference is concerned, I seem to recall the '99 putting out around 360 FPS, whereas the 92FS claims around 460 FPS in the manual, so yes, it's a little more powerful.

    People on here have fitted over-barrel silencers to their Berettas, although I don't honestly know how much quieter they'd make it. Bear in mind that those type of silencers will leave nasty grub-screw marks on that nice satin Nickel finish - if you're happy with that, then go ahead.

    Expect to pay around the £100 mark for a boxed, good condition used example - you should get some CO2 bulbs and a tin of pellets thrown in at that price, too.

    With regard to the laser, it depends which laser it is. The Umarex trigger lasers sell from between £45 - £60 new, and a Beamshot will set you back around 45 quid. I'd say £25 or £30 was a fair price for a secondhand laser.

    I had both. The CP99 had a shorter barrel and was less accurate with a not so good trigger. The 92 is a much better pistol and you can get silencers that attach via grub screw to the lip around the barrel-the OE wasn't all that. I would get the 92 and get UKNeil to make a silencer to fit. By the way co2 pistols have a lot of sound escaping the area near the breach so you would still heara crack.
